Estimación de la temperatura basal del “Glaciar Norte” del volcán Citlaltépetl, México. Modelo para determinar la presencia de permafrost subglaciar

Abstract: Se estudian las condiciones de temperatura y la conductividad del hielo del “Glaciar Norte” del volcán Citlaltépetl con el objeto de determinar la existencia de permafrost basal. A partir de registros de temperatura cercanos a la superficie se estimó la temperatura media en estado estacionario del interior del “Glaciar Norte” mediante un método sinusoidal que utiliza las propiedades termo-conductoras del hielo. “…Due to the altitude of 4700 m a.s.l. of the glacial ice line until 1975 on the north face, the isolated portions of discontinuous permafrost must be the product of that glacial retreat (Soto-Molina et al, 2019). The possible existence of basal permafrost inside the main Citlaltépetl glacier can be suggested because the basement in the deepest part (115 meters) is preserved at -2.48 °C throughout the year without registering the minimum temperature oscillation.…”
